Transaction 14bab43c7daf8676a074343b57d1521a1a2bdac332b5d40f2dd7bc1acbd587b3
1 Input
1 Output
-
14bab43c7daf8676a074343b57d1521a1a2bdac332b5d40f2dd7bc1acbd587b3:0
- value
- 16888305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ee7ccbc6298abab2234c33415fc7292081f9348d OP_EQUAL
- address
- MVeAZ4dX9oBVvpFLj5Qw8UDKT89nvVCWQd